Hey daniel I hiked to ghost peak (near cartier) from RMR today and can certainly say a bike would just slow you down. Not to mention you would have to get your bike up mount mackenzie without a gondola to use (no mtbs on the gondy). It is about 8km from the top of upper gondola to the basin between cartier and ghost and then another ~2km up cartier with significant vert gain. The whole ridge over to there is undulating and often rocky and steep. There is some nice meadows but I doubt you would be happy with a bike. -Jaron
